> > Deep breath:
> >
> >
> >
> > If I want to get 100 people (currently in an nt4 domain/XCH 5.5 SP4)
> > asap
> on
> > xch2k OWA will this work:
> >
> >
> >
> > Install 1 backend exch2k server in my 5.5 site
> >
> > Install 1 frontend exch2k server in my 5.5 site
> >
> >
> >
> > (or just consolidate these onto 1 server and punch port 80/443 through
> > firewall?)
> >
> >
> >
> > Install 2 AD domain controllers (split roles) for accounts (We have AD
> plan
> > written, so we would start enough of this to get us going)
> >
> >
> >
> > Make 2 way trust between nt4 domain and ad
> >
> >
> >
> > Migrate users mailboxes to exch2k server (ADMT or Quest tool)
> >
> >
> >
> > Users with mailboxes on exch2k server either have to log into ad or
> > log
> into
> > nt4 and authenticate every time they use Outlook
> >
> > Thank you for any opinions or suggestions!
